  • Vineyard Profile

    • The name Californio pays tribute to the early California settlers, or Californios, those of Spanish heritage who tamed the wilds of the frontier. As descendants of the early Californios, the Hyde and de Villaine families strive to present a Syrah that highlights one of California’s premier growing sites, Hyde Vineyard, while embodying the elegance of the Old World.

    • Appellation: Los Caneros
    • Vine Age: 12 - 18 years
    • Soil: Shallow loam over clay hardpan
  • Vintage Report

    • Hyde Vineyard experienced moderate to high temperatures during the 2012 growing season. The warm weather was complimented by cool nights and no significant weather events. The growing season was longer than the previous two with harvest completed on October 18th. This vintage will be remembered for its definition and balance.

    • Harvest Date(s): October 6 and 18, 2012

  • Tasting Notes

    • Rich garnet in color, this wine expresses exuberant aromatics blackberry, red cherry and violet on the nose. The palate is attractive with loads of ripe black and blue berries, delicate floral blossoms, dried tobacco and tea leaf, and a refined elegant tannin structure. At its core, the Syrah has firm acidity, a pleasant mineral component, and a touch of earth.
      – Stéphane Vivier, Winemaker
